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How much does a top accident lawyer cost?
A lot of accident attorneys operate on a contingency cost basis. This means the client pays nothing in advance. Rather, the attorney takes an agreed-upon portion (usually in between 33% and 40%) of the final settlement or court award. If the lawyer fails to recuperate settlement, the client owes no lawyer costs.
2. How long will my individual injury case require to fix?
Every case is special. Simple claims with clear liability and small injuries might settle within a couple of months. However, complicated cases including severe injuries, challenged liability, or persistent insurance coverage companies can take a year or longer, specifically if lawsuits and trial become required.
3. What if I was partially at fault for the accident?
Many states run under comparative neglect laws. Even if a victim shares a portion of the blame (e.g., 20% at fault), they might still be able to recuperate payment, though the last award will generally be decreased by their percentage of fault. A leading lawyer can help decrease assigned fault and take full advantage of recovery.
4. Should I accept the preliminary settlement offer from the insurance provider?
Rarely. Initial deals are practically always lowball figures developed to close the claim quickly and inexpensively before the complete degree of injuries-- and future medical requirements-- are known. Consulting an attorney before signing any releases is highly advised.
